I have an 05 duramax with the allison, all is stock. I hooked to an empty gooseneck today and put it in 4 wheel drive to get up a muddy drive way. When I got to the pavement I forgot to put it in 2 wheel drive. After about a 25 mile drive I stopped at a stop sign and when I started to go the tranny stalled for a second then slammed forward. After that it wouldn't shift out of 1st. I took it real slow and got home. When I unhooked the trailer I killed the truck and let it sit for a few minutes. I then cranked it up and moved forward still won't shift. When I put it in reverse it jerks real hard going into gear. Any ideas what might be going on?

If that doesn't work check with the dealer about a flush. I know the Allison is different than the one in the gas burners but this might apply, varnish builds up on the valves and causes shifting problems. A can of something is poured in the transmission then you drive for a few days then the transmission is hooked to a machine that pumps out the old oil and pumps in the new.
 
Never been into one of the Allisons but if I were a bettin' feller I'd be puttin' money on the innards of the transfer case. You've probably welded some gears together. If it is the transfer box you might be glad $$$$ wise.
